Detroit Truck Accident Lawyer Gerald H. Acker Comments On Wayne County Crackdown On Overloaded Tractor Trailers
Detroit, MI (PRWEB) November 15, 2013 -- The Law Offices of Goodman Acker, P.C., today announced it was pleased to learn about an effort to crack down on overweight tractor-trailer trucks in Brownstown Township.
The Detroit Free Press (“Added patrols will target overweight trucks in Brownstown Township,” October 7) reported that the effort to reduce overloaded and overweight trucks came in response to concerns that these trucks were damaging Michigan roadways and creating dangerous driving conditions.
The partnership between Brownstown Township and the Wayne’s County Sheriff’s Office will result in a larger police presence on township streets beginning in November, according to the article. Detroit truck accident attorney Gerald H. Acker of Goodman Acker, P.C., said serious accidents involving catastrophic and fatal injuries can sometimes be traced back to overloaded tractor trailers.
“Overloaded and overweight tractor trailer trucks present a number of dangers to drivers. These trucks are much more difficult to control or stop. They can cause brake failure or blowouts. They can jackknife or tip over due to their weight,” said Acker, who represents victims of negligence and families who lost loved ones in accidents. “They also can cause extra wear and tear on our roads and highways, which can be costly for taxpayers in addition to creating a safety hazard.”
According to the Detroit Free Press, the additional police presence is designed to limit the amount of overweight trucks that make their way into the municipality, which is one of a number of Wayne County municipalities that have already enacted similar measures in trying to reduce the amount of overloaded vehicles on their roadways.
Truck companies and drivers who overload their trailers will face fines, the Detroit Free Press article said. Individual towns and the state’s Municipal Support Enforcement Unit will split the revenue generated through fines, the article stated.
